Wow - great discovery in Kenya! Chinese Ming dynasty porcelain and coin in a coastal town. More evidence that possibly the legend of Cheng He could be true ... he reached the African coast before any western power. http://www.bbc.co.uk/news/world-africa-11531398  And how about the theory that some chinese sailors remained and married local Kenyans - DNA tests seem to prove it's true ... some Kenyans in the region have chinese blood. You just might have a very long lost relative who's Kenyan ... I wonder from which parts of China the sailors came from. Cheng He (aka San Bo aka Sinbad) was himself a muslim; descendent of the Persian general Sayyid Ajjal Shams who served in the Mongol court.
